About the Business

Looking for a professional and reliable mobile locksmith service in Denver, Colorado? We offer lock repair, and installation, for your Car, Home, and Business!

Additional Information

Receive Credit Card:
No
Delivery:
No

Location & Hours

2150 South Bellaire Street, Denver, Colorado 80222, United States, USA

Business Hours

Open 24

Subscribe Now

Get All Updates & Advance Offers